Fundamental Parts of a Cairns Fire Helmet
A Cairns fire helmet is engineered to provide firefighters with the utmost protection on the fireground. To achieve this, it's comprised of several vital components. Firstly, the casing is usually made from a durable, impact-withstanding material like fiberglass or Kevlar. This provides a strong barrier against falling objects and potential trauma. Inside the headgear, a plush liner helps distribute stress evenly across the head while minimizing friction.
- Breath-ability features are crucial for keeping firefighters cool and alert during intense operations. Cairns helmets often incorporate multiple portals strategically placed to allow for maximum airflow.
- Face shields offer essential visual security against flying debris, sparks, and heat. Some visors are also durable to provide an added layer of safety.
- Headlamps are becoming increasingly common in modern Cairns helmets. These built-in lights can significantly improve visibility during low-light or night-time operations, making them invaluable for firefighters working in dangerous environments.
